The Role of Trading Commissions in Swing Trading Profitability

Swing trading is a popular investment strategy where traders hold positions for several days or weeks, aiming to capitalize on short- to medium-term price movements. While many factors influence the success of swing trading, one often overlooked aspect is the role of trading commissions. These costs can significantly impact overall profitability, especially for active traders.

Understanding Trading Commissions

Trading commissions are fees charged by brokers each time a trader executes a buy or sell order. These fees can be a flat rate per trade or a percentage of the transaction amount. Some brokers also charge additional fees such as spreads, which are the difference between the bid and ask prices.

Impact on Swing Trading Profitability

Since swing traders often make multiple trades within a single week or month, commissions can accumulate quickly. High trading fees can eat into profits, especially when gains per trade are modest. For example, if a trader makes ten trades with a $10 commission each, that totals $100 in costs, which can negate small profits or even turn a winning strategy into a losing one.

Strategies to Minimize Commission Costs

  • Choose low-cost or commission-free brokers.
  • Limit the number of trades by focusing on high-probability setups.
  • Use limit orders to control entry and exit points, reducing unnecessary trades.
  • Combine trades when possible to reduce total transaction costs.

Balancing Cost and Strategy

While cutting costs is important, traders must also consider the quality of their trading strategy. Sometimes, paying slightly higher commissions can be justified if it means executing more reliable trades. The key is to find a balance that maximizes net profit after all costs.
